The Notre Dame AD was non-committal about the future but says Notre Dame is in a very strong position. He said he expects the B1G and SEC to eventually go to 20 teams and he doesn't see a third power conference emerging from the ACC/Big 12/PAC. Praised the B1G for adding USC and UCLA. Complained about the long 18 hour travel days when Olympic sports have to visit FSU. No mention of the ACC's GOR being an impediment to their future decisions.
“So there’s a bit of a ‘Big 2, Next-Level-3 and Group of 5’ in a way that there wasn’t prior to this, or won’t be when the moves are completed.
